Compare specifications (specs)
| NVIDIA P106-090 | NVIDIA GeForce 6800 GT | |
|---|---|---|
Essentials |
||
| Architecture | Pascal | Curie |
| Code name | GP106 | NV40 A1 |
| Launch date | 31 July 2017 | 14 April 2004 |
| Place in performance rating | 852 | 849 |
| Type | Desktop | Desktop |
Technical info |
||
| Boost clock speed | 1531 MHz | |
| Core clock speed | 1354 MHz | 350 MHz |
| Floating-point performance | 2,352 gflops | |
| Manufacturing process technology | 16 nm | 130 nm |
| Pipelines | 768 | |
| Texture fill rate | 73.49 GTexel / s | 5.6 GTexel / s |
| Thermal Design Power (TDP) | 75 Watt | 67 Watt |
| Transistor count | 4,400 million | 222 million |
Video outputs and ports |
||
| Display Connectors | No outputs | 1x DVI, 1x VGA, 1x S-Video |
Compatibility, dimensions and requirements |
||
| Interface | PCIe 3.0 x16 | AGP 8x |
| Length | 250 mm | |
| Supplementary power connectors | 1x 6-pin | 1x Molex |
API support |
||
| DirectX | 12.0 (12_1) | 9.0c |
| OpenGL | 4.6 | 2.1 |
Memory |
||
| Maximum RAM amount | 3 GB | 256 MB |
| Memory bandwidth | 192.2 GB / s | 32.0 GB / s |
| Memory bus width | 192 Bit | 256 Bit |
| Memory clock speed | 8008 MHz | 700 MHz |
| Memory type | GDDR5 | GDDR3 |
